Osaka is Japan's vibrant second-largest city and the heart of the Kansai region, known for exceptional food, nightlife, and culture with excellent connectivity to nearby Kyoto and Kobe. The city is divided into two main districts: the upscale Umeda in the north and the lively downtown Namba in the south, connected by the Midōsuji boulevard.

Getting around
Navigate the city using the Midosuji subway line connecting Umeda and Namba, or the JR Osaka Loop Line that encircles the city center.
What to eat
Osaka is known as 'the Nation's Kitchen' with exceptional food culture; the kuidaore philosophy celebrates indulgence in food and drink throughout the city.
Tips
Allow up to 30 minutes for walking between different station areas with the same name, as they may belong to different railway companies and be in different locations.
